学生成绩查询表系统数据库设计指南 (学生成绩查询表系统数据库设计)

随着教育信息化的发展,学生成绩查询系统已经成为各大学校必不可少的管理工具,它能方便快捷地实现学生和教师互动,为学校管理和教学提供重要的参考依据。因此,学生学籍信息系统的建设和管理也越来越重要,数据库的设计和管理成为学生学籍信息系统的关键部分之一。

数据库设计的目标是尽可能地利用数据库中的各种信息,实现信息处理、数据分析、数据挖掘等一系列的操作,帮助学校管理人员更好地进行学生学籍管理。在本文中,我们将介绍学生成绩查询表系统数据库设计的指南,为读者提供参考并帮助读者更好地进行数据库的设计和管理。

在进行学生成绩查询表系统数据库设计前,我们需要注意以下几点:

1. 数据库设计需要根据学校的具体需求来进行,设置符合实际操作的数据处理机制。

2. 数据库设计需要充分考虑数据的规范化。

3. 数据库设计需要做好数据的保护和安全性。

接着,我们将介绍学生成绩查询表系统数据库设计的具体指南,包括以下方面:

1. 数据库结构设计

数据库的结构设计是数据库设计的最基本和核心部分,它决定了数据库的组织方式和数据的存储方式。在学生成绩查询表系统数据库设计中,我们需要确定数据库的表格结构和表格之间的关联关系,并根据学校的具体需求来设计相关的表格。

常规的表格设计包括学生表、课程表、成绩表等,其中学生表存储学生基本信息,课程表存储课程信息,成绩表存储学生的考试成绩信息等。同时,根据学校的具体需求,可能还需要设计班级表、教师表和教室表等表格,以更好地完成学生成绩查询系统的设计。

2. 数据采集和导入

学生学籍信息的采集和导入是学生成绩查询表系统数据库设计的重要部分。在数据采集和导入过程中,需要注意以下几点:

(1) 在采集学生学籍信息时,需要严格按照学生身份证号码进行录入,保证数据的准确性和唯一性。

(2) 采集教师、课程和教室信息时,需要准确地记录相关信息,以确保数据的正确性。

(3) 数据导入过程需要对数据进行校验,以确保数据的有效性。

3. 数据的保护和安全性

保护数据安全和保密性是学生成绩查询表系统数据库设计的重要任务之一。在数据的存储过程中,需要采用一系列措施来保证数据的保密性和完整性,包括数据备份、数据加密等措施。

此外,还需要对敏感数据进行访问权限控制,防止未经授权访问和修改数据,以确保数据的安全性和保密性。

4. 数据分析和查询

通过对学生成绩查询表系统数据库的分析和查询,可以为学校管理提供重要的参考信息,帮助学校制定更好的教学计划和学生管理规划。在进行数据分析和查询时,需要注意以下几点:

(1) 需要根据学校的实际情况来设计合适的查询界面和查询方法。

(2) 在进行查询时,需要确保准确地输入查询条件,以确保查询的准确性和完整性。

(3) 需要在数据分析和查询过程中注意数据的规范化,确保查询结果的正确性和有效性。

综上所述,学生成绩查询表系统数据库设计需要充分考虑学校的具体需求和实际操作要求,并在数据采集、数据保护和安全性、数据分析和查询等方面做好相关工作,以确保学生成绩查询系统的正常运行和有效使用,更好地帮助学校管理人员进行学生学籍管理和教学管理,提高学校管理和教学水平。

相关问题拓展阅读:

设计一个学生成绩管理系统,学生成绩信息包括:学号,姓名,四门课成绩,实现功能如下:

这个程序大了点吧。。

//我简单写,请借鉴:

#include “stdafx.h”

#include “

stdio.h

#include “

string.h

#include “math.h”

#include “time.h”

#include “string.h”

 

  

  

#include

using namespace std;

  

struct Student//定义学生结构

{

    char id;//id

    char name;     //姓名

    char res;//成绩

    int end;//存储时显示换行, 可去掉

    Student(){end = 0x0a0d;}  //回车,换行

 

}list;//100个账号, 测试

  

void main()

{

    srand((unsigned)time(0));//种子

    char buf;   //缓存

  

    //初始化学生100名

    int i;

    for(i=0;i

    {

   核顷     strcpy(list.id ,itoa(i,buf,10));

strcpy(list.name ,”某人”);

  嫌嫌      strcpy(list.res, itoa(rand()%100,buf, 10));

    }

  

    //保存数据

    FILE * pf = fopen(“data.txt”, “wb”);

  

    for(i=0;i

    {

fwrite(&list, sizeof(Student), 1, pf);

    }

    fclose(pf);

  

    //读出数据

    Student list_1;     //新数组

    pf = fopen(“data.txt”, “rb”);

    for(i=0;i

    {

fread( &list_1, sizeof(Student), 1, pf);

    }

  

    //显示 list_1 测试

    for(i=0;i

    {

 改者陆cout.id.name .res

    }

  

 

 

}

用c#做一个管理页面连上数据库就可以了

关于学生成绩查询表系统数据库设计的介绍到此就结束了,不知道你从中找到你需要的信息了吗 ?如果你还想了解更多这方面的信息,记得收藏关注本站。


数据运维技术 » 学生成绩查询表系统数据库设计指南 (学生成绩查询表系统数据库设计)